According to offline retail data from Grips Intelligence covering January 1 to June 30, 2026 across tracked channels including Home Depot, Lowe's, Amazon, Ace Hardware, and Newegg, Premier's revenue declined 34.8% over the period, with a further 16.8% month-over-month drop in the most recent month. Home Depot dominated Premier's channel mix, accounting for 65.0% of year-to-date revenue, followed distantly by Lowe's at 17.6% and Amazon at 9.0%. The brand's average product price rose 2.9% across the full period, reaching $54.86 in the most recent month after a 14.8% month-over-month increase. Overall, the average product price stood at $63.84. This mix of concentrated channel reliance and rising prices against falling revenue makes Premier's in-store performance a notable case in the appliance category.
